An admitted U.S. Army deserter was held in lieu of $100,000 bail Sunday after a traffic stop on the Edens Expressway led to his arrest this weekend.
Joseph Michael Kelly, 35, a bartender who lives in the 3200 block of West Waveland, faces various gun and drug charges in addition to being a fugitive from justice.
Kelly was the passenger of a silver Ford Focus police said they pulled over about 8:50 p.m. Saturday just south of Touhy Avenue on the northbound side of Interstate 94. They said the car didn't have a rear registration light.
Officers said they smelled marijuana inside the car. And the driver, Tricia Walker, admitted she had a small amount of the drug in the car, according to police reports. Kelly initially denied it, police said, and refused to let officers search the vehicle.
Police said he eventually admitted the marijuana was in the car, though. He also told the officers about a loaded gun they later found under the driver's seat, in addition to the three grams of marijuana they found under the passenger seat and the small black pipe found on the rear floor board, according to reports.
Kelly also told them he was AWOL from the Army, police said.
